CHEVIOT FEMALES TO £1,500
At Longtown on Tuesday 17th February 2026, C & D Auction Marts Ltd. conducted the fifth annual show and sale of 34 Hill (South Country) Cheviot in-lamb females and select geld hoggs for the Cheviot Sheep Society.
There was a crowded ringside in attendance with an encouraging number of younger breeders present, allied to some significant on-line bidding.

Champion a Four Crop Ewe sold for 1500gns from RH Paton Castle Crawford
The judge, Ian McKnight of New Luce found his champion in the pen of R.H. Paton, Castle Crawford, awarding the honour to a tremendous four-crop show ewe by Stirkfield Aftershock. Scanned triplets to Glenochar Riot, she sold for the top price of the evening, 1,500 guineas to David Morrison, Dalwyne Farm, Barr. Castle Crawford also topped the gimmer section with the 1,400 guinea sale of a 2nd prize Becks Twister daughter, in-lamb to the £18,000 Skelfhill VIP, to M.E. Scott, Yethousefields, Newcastleton. With another gimmer, by Townfoot Smartass, at 1,200 guineas, to Liam Matheson, Ballachraggan, Ross-shire, Castle Crawford`s pen of four averaged £1,233.
At 1,100 guineas, J.T. Fleming & Son of Hislop sold a Catslack King gimmer, in lamb to a Catslack ram; the Catslack connection continued with her purchaser being Messrs W.N. Douglas of Catslackburn, Yarrow.

Reserve Champion a Gimmer sold for 1000gns from J and D Hodge Dykes Farm
The reserve championship was taken by first-time consignors, J. & D. Hodge, Dykes Farm Auchinleck. Their gimmer, by Becks Take a Chance and in-lamb to Woodburn Absolute made 1,000 guineas to David Morrison who was also buyer of the champion. A regular supporter of this sale but a first-time consignor, Ewen MacMillan of Lurg, Fintry had a Townfoot Iceman gimmer at 1,000 guineas which went to W.N. Douglas. Two ewes sold at 950 guineas, these being a 2nd prizewinner from Langholm Initiative, Cooms and from Messrs Elliot, Hindhope, who had others at 900 guineas and 800 guineas. J. Common & Son, Crossdykes sold two gimmers at 900 guineas each and topped the geld-hogg section with a 750 guinea sale.
Ewes averaged £791; Gimmers £827 and Hoggs £630.
